JOB SUMMARY

The Energy Program Analyst is responsible for supporting energy management programs and initiatives to achieve energy savings and reductions across the entire district. Performs energy data collection, analysis, and reporting to track performance against past data to maintain or improve energy consumption. Collaborate with other departments and external vendors to ensure the integration of energy‑saving measures into facility operations and project plans.

Assist in developing comprehensive energy management strategies. Develop and execute site specific Energy Management Plans. Performs evening and weekend audits as well as overseeing all the district building automation system scheduling. This position is eligible for limited remote work as approved by your supervisor.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
  • Monitor energy consumption by site and address issues as well as look for additional savings.
  • Utilizing project management and energy analysis software.
  • Identification of energy conservation opportunities.
  • Energy Star – understand the energy star program and model our buildings around those parameters.
  • Stay informed about the latest developments in energy technology and practices.
  • Master control of district wide set points and setbacks for HVAC utilizing the districts BAS system.
  • Act as the district’s first point of contact for BAS issues and comfort concerns.
  • Train with district’s BAS vendor to maximize the use of the current BAS system.
  • Utilize a district owned BAS system computer from remote locations as needed.
  • Perform energy audits, retro‑commissioning, and system optimization activities.
  • Annually reviews site equipment for any changes for efficiency and productivity.
  • Building walkthroughs reviewing energy usage after hours. Including nights, weekends, and some holidays.
  • Other duties as assigned.
